Public Member Functions | |
void | commit () |
bool | isActive () |
OraTransaction (const cond::DbSession &session) | |
void | rollback () |
virtual | ~OraTransaction () |
Public Member Functions inherited from cond::persistency::ITransaction | |
virtual | ~ITransaction () |
Private Attributes | |
cond::DbSession | m_session |
Additional Inherited Members | |
Public Attributes inherited from cond::persistency::ITransaction | |
size_t | clients = 0 |
bool | gtDbExists = false |
bool | gtDbOpen = false |
bool | iovDbExists = false |
bool | iovDbOpen = false |
bool | isOra = false |
Definition at line 38 of file SessionImpl.cc.
|
inline |
|
inlinevirtual |
Definition at line 44 of file SessionImpl.cc.
|
inlinevirtual |
Implements cond::persistency::ITransaction.
Definition at line 46 of file SessionImpl.cc.
References cond::DbTransaction::commit(), m_session, and cond::DbSession::transaction().
|
inlinevirtual |
Implements cond::persistency::ITransaction.
Definition at line 53 of file SessionImpl.cc.
References cond::DbTransaction::isActive(), m_session, and cond::DbSession::transaction().
|
inlinevirtual |
Implements cond::persistency::ITransaction.
Definition at line 50 of file SessionImpl.cc.
References m_session, cond::DbTransaction::rollback(), and cond::DbSession::transaction().
|
private |
Definition at line 57 of file SessionImpl.cc.
Referenced by commit(), isActive(), and rollback().